Congress should bring campus transparency into the defense bill
Summary
The article says Congress should improve rules about foreign money given to U.S. universities. It suggests making schools report smaller amounts and fully revealing funds from certain countries.Key Facts
- The current rules about foreign money coming into U.S. colleges are weak.
- The National Defense Authorization Act (a law governing defense spending) could include changes on this issue.
- The article wants the reporting threshold lowered, meaning schools report even smaller payments.
- It asks for full disclosure when money comes from countries that may pose a risk.
- The goal is to increase transparency and reduce potential dangers linked to foreign funding in universities.
